Şerbettar railway station (Turkish: Şerbettar istasyonu) is a station in the village of Şerbettar, Turkey in East Thrace.
The station is located on an unnamed road in the extreme northwest of the village.
[1] TCDD Taşımacılık operates a daily regional train from Istanbul to Kapıkule, which stops at Şerbettar.
[2] The station consists of a short side platform servicing one track.
The station was opened in 1971 by the Turkish State Railways.
